264. The Space Between Who You Were and Who You’re Becoming

In this episode of Breakthrough Mode, we’re wrapping up a powerful week focused on staying in the space—the often uncomfortable, rarely talked about phase of growth that happens after you let go, but before you fully become.

After a full month of decluttering your physical space, digital life, mental load, and identity, it’s natural to want to rush into what’s next.

To fill the space.
To move faster.
To become instantly.

But real transformation doesn’t work that way.

In this episode, you'll learn:

  • Why growth isn’t a clean, one-to-one trade-off
  • The truth about the “gap” between who you were and who you’re becoming
  • Why you feel uncertain, impatient, or even lost during change
  • How fear, doubt, and impatience show up in the in-between
  • Why most people revert back to old patterns
  • The role of intentionality in creating a new identity
  • How to stay committed even when you don’t see proof yet

You’re not behind—you’re in the middle. And if you can stay in the discomfort of becoming just a little longer, you’ll realize this space isn’t where you’re stuck… it’s where you’re changing.
